FAQS about Does energy storage need to be registered with the power company

Who regulates energy storage in Texas?

Three main entities regulate energy storage in Texas: ERCOT (Electric Reliability Council of Texas) operates about 90% of the state's power grid and governs how electricity flows across it in real time. ERCOT sets market rules and technical standards for energy participants.

Are battery energy storage systems a good idea in Texas?

Battery energy storage systems (BESS) are becoming vital to ensuring grid reliability, balancing intermittent renewable sources, and enabling a flexible, modernized power system. But while the opportunity is enormous, the rules governing energy storage in Texas can be complex.

Why is electricity storage important?

Depending on the extent to which it is deployed, electricity storage could help the utility grid operate more efficiently, reduce the likelihood of brownouts during peak demand, and allow for more renewable resources to be built and used. Energy can be stored in a variety of ways, including: Pumped hydroelectric.

How do energy storage systems work?

Energy storage systems, such as large-scale lithium-ion batteries, store excess electricity generated during periods of low demand or high renewable output. When demand rises or generation falters (for instance, during a winter storm), these systems can release stored power back into the grid.

Uganda Large Energy Storage Power Station

Uganda Large Energy Storage Power Station

Uganda has approved a major 100 MW solar project paired with a 250 MWh battery storage system—a landmark initiative for solar energy in Uganda. This ambitious project is designed to strengthen grid stability and accelerate the country's transition to renewable energy.. The Government of Uganda has authorized the development of a 100 MWp solar PV and 250 MWh battery storage project. A major solar-plus-storage has been approved by the Government of Uganda, with the project set for Kapeeka Sub‑County, Nakaseke District, approximately 62 kilometers northwest of. . The Government of Uganda authorised the construction of a 100 MW solar photovoltaic plant with a 250 MWh battery energy storage system in Kapeeka. The facility will be developed by U.S.-based Energy America, with its East Africa subsidiary, EA Astrovolt, serving as lead project developer and. . Located in Kapeeka, Nakaseke District, the plant will be equipped with technology designed for tropical and equatorial climates. Image: Raze Solar via Unsplash. The world s tallest energy storage power station

The world s tallest energy storage power station

China, Jiangsu Province: China has completed construction of the Zhenjiang (Jurong) Pumped Storage Power Station, the world's tallest pumped storage dam and a landmark in large-scale renewable energy storage.. China, Jiangsu Province: China has completed construction of the Zhenjiang (Jurong) Pumped Storage Power Station, the world's tallest pumped storage dam and a landmark in large-scale renewable energy storage.. On October 28, the Jurong Pumped Storage Power Station in Jiangsu, developed by State Grid Xinyuan Company, was officially put into full operation. As the world's tallest dam-based pumped storage power station, this mega project features: The station serves as a crucial clean energy regulator. . The 182-m Zhenjiang facility will store renewable energy for over 360,000 households. Located in Jurong City, the plant is equipped with six 225-megawatt reversible pump-turbine generator. .
